We are thrilled to share that Hurja Halla’s second album, Surma hiihti, has received a glowing 4-star review in the latest issue of Songlines Magazine.

In the review, critic Chris Wheatley describes the album as a ”notable release” that draws deep inspiration from mythology and nature.
The review highlights the unique blend of cello, mouth harp, flute, and percussion, commenting it ”blended to perfection”.
”’Teeren tanssi’ is a high, bright and wistful affair, shot through with warmth and joy, while ’Otsoseni ainoiseni’ summons visions of dark winter landscapes lit by acres of pure white snow. ”
It is an honor to be featured in such a prestigious global music publication alongside other fantastic Nordic artists. A huge thank you to Songlines and Chris Wheatley for the kind words!
